How they compare
Ukraine currently reports 17,541 kg of oil equivalent per capita against 17,191 kg of oil equivalent per capita in Barbados, a difference of 350 kg of oil equivalent per capita.
Across all 5 years both countries report, Ukraine has been ahead every year.
Barbados ranks 81st and Ukraine ranks 78th of 174 countries.
Ukraine has averaged higher in every one of the 2 decades both report.

About this data
Annual energy use per capita, measured in kilowatt-hours per person vs. gross domestic product (GDP) per capita, which is adjusted for inflation and differences in living costs between countries.
